What Actually Happens When You Rebuild

No mystery. No runaround. Here's the whole process.

Our own crews handle emergency mitigation start to finish. For rebuilds, we manage every trade under one accountable team.

01

We scope it line-by-line

A detailed, line-item estimate of everything the rebuild requires — written in the same format your adjuster uses, and shared with them directly. No vague lump sums.

02

We handle permits & code

We know the permit process in every municipality we work in, and we build to current code — so inspections pass and your rebuild is legitimate, not a liability when you sell.

03

We rebuild the structure

TRC manages framing, drywall, flooring, cabinetry, trim, and paint on one schedule, with one accountable point of contact.

04

We coordinate the specialty trades

Licensed electricians and plumbers are brought in whenever the work requires it. TRC manages the schedule and remains the accountable point of contact.

05

We finish with a walkthrough you sign off on

We're not done until you've walked the whole job with us and put your name on it. Your sign-off is the finish line, not our invoice.

The Insurance Part

The questions everyone asks about the rebuild.

Q.What should I do first after property damage?

Make sure everyone is safe. Stop the source only if it's safe to do so. Call TRC right away so we can protect and document the property — and notify your insurer promptly. We'll help you understand what your carrier will ask for.

Q.Will you work directly with my insurance company?

We document losses and coordinate with insurance carriers. We prepare a line-item rebuild scope and supporting documentation for adjuster review.

Q.What if the insurance estimate doesn't cover the full rebuild?

That's common, and it's exactly where having one accountable contractor helps. When we find work the original estimate missed, we document it and file a supplement with your adjuster — advocating for what your home actually needs to be made whole.

Q.Do I pay you, or does insurance?

We bill your insurance directly. We explain the project-specific payment schedule before work begins.

Q.Can I upgrade finishes while you’re rebuilding?

Absolutely — and it's often the smart time to do it. Insurance covers restoring what was there; if you want to upgrade cabinets, flooring, or fixtures, you typically pay the difference, and we'll price that out clearly up front.
